Introduction
Glyceraldehyde 3-phosphate dehydrogenase (GAPDH) is an enzyme that plays a crucial role in glycolysis, a metabolic pathway that converts glucose into energy. GAPDH catalyzes the reversible conversion of glyceraldehyde 3-phosphate to 1,3-bisphosphoglycerate. This enzyme is a tetramer, meaning it consists of four identical subunits, each with a molecular weight of 36 kDa. Beyond its function in glycolysis, GAPDH participates in various cellular processes, including membrane fusion, microtubule organization, phosphotransferase activity, nuclear RNA export, DNA replication, and DNA repair.
Description
This product consists of recombinant mouse GAPDH protein produced in E. coli. It is a single, non-glycosylated polypeptide chain containing 356 amino acids (amino acids 1-333) and has a molecular mass of 38.2 kDa. A 23 amino acid His-tag is fused to the N-terminus of the protein to facilitate purification, which is achieved using proprietary chromatographic techniques.
Physical Appearance
Clear, colorless, and sterile-filtered solution.
Formulation
The GAPDH protein is provided at a concentration of 0.25 mg/ml in a solution of phosphate-buffered saline (pH 7.4) containing 20% glycerol and 1 mM dithiothreitol (DTT).
Stability
For short-term storage (up to 2-4 weeks), the product can be stored at 4°C. For long-term storage, it is recommended to freeze the product at -20°C. The addition of a carrier protein such as bovine serum albumin (BSA) or human serum albumin (HSA) to a final concentration of 0.1% is advised for long-term storage. Repeated freeze-thaw cycles should be avoided to maintain protein stability.
Purity
The purity of the GAPDH protein is greater than 95% as determined by SDS-polyacrylamide gel electrophoresis (SDS-PAGE).
